Web10 mrt. 2024 · When to take medicine for high LDL cholesterol? Your health care provider may prescribe medicine if: You have already had a heart attack or stroke, or you have peripheral arterial disease. Your LDL cholesterol level is 190 mg/dL or higher. You are 40–75 years old with diabetes and an LDL cholesterol level of 70 mg/dL or higher. Web19 dec. 2024 · Sidebar Articles. The Statin Shuffle. Web22 okt. 2024 · Niacin. Niacin, also known as nicotinic acid and vitamin B3, is available both over-the-counter and by prescription. Prescription niacin has been shown to lower LDL cholesterol and triglycerides and increase HDL cholesterol. Over-the-counter niacin may be able to lower cholesterol, but likely at a much lower rate. WebDr. Petra M.J.C. Kuijpers. The story of lipids in humans starts in 1769 when François Poulletier de la Salle identified solid cholesterol in gallstones. History evolved from Anichkov’s early basis for the “Lipid Hypothesis” (1913), via the discovery of lipoproteins (1929) and the major work of “the father of clinical lipidology” John ... WebHigh cholesterol is when you have high amounts of cholesterol in the blood. Cholesterol is essential in order for your body to continue building healthy cells, however having high cholesterol can increase your risk of heart disease. This is because it can lead to a build-up of fatty deposits in your blood vessels, which overtime can make it ...

Web21 jan. 2024 · In addition to eating a heart-healthy diet and exercising, taking cholesterol-lowering medications may be necessary for people with high LDL levels. Statins are the most common medication for high cholesterol. They tend to have mild side effects, but you should not take them if you are pregnant or breastfeeding.
